Problem

In team match games, one-sided matches lead to player disengagement and a need for systems to provide opportunities for the inferior team to break through disadvantageous situations, while balanced offense and defense can result in game deadlocks requiring a system to change the situation for excitement.

Innovation Solution

A computer system adjusts capture difficulty of intermediate bases in a team match game by modifying capture conditions and fighting parameter values based on team superiority or inferiority, using gauges to determine team progress and adjust capture difficulty to assist the inferior team.

AI summary

A computer system performs progress control of a game where a first team and a second team fight with each other in a game space including settings of a first team headquarters, a second team headquarters, and at least one intermediate base that either of the teams can alternately capture to use as a base. A game screen includes display of headquarters gauges whose gauge values increase or decrease in accordance with headquarters parameter values indicating conquered degrees of the first team headquarters and the second team headquarters. Capture difficulty of the intermediate base is adjusted based on the gauge values of the respective headquarters gauges of the first team and the second team.
